The Gates Scholarship
Due Sept 15
  • High school senior, Pell-eligible, US citizen or permanent resident, minimum 3.3 cumulative weighted GPA. thegatesscholarship.org

  • The committee prioritizes outstanding academic records, ideally the top 10 percent of your graduating class. thegatesscholarship.org

  • Funded by the Gates Foundation, but administered on their behalf by the Hispanic Scholarship Fund. thegatesscholarship.org
